I replaced my Alt with a HO Iraggi Alternator rated at 240/165 idle.

since installing that my battery light is on the whole time.
i got it checked and its charging properly, my voltage is perfect also.

is this normal?

i found the problem with my light. i had my wife sit in the seat and let me know when the light when off. i was wiggling the alt. cable and the light went off and on as i pushed it around. so im thinking my cable is bad before i replace the alt. try that out see what happens.
